Обновление [Ссылки могут видеть только зарегистрированные пользователи. ]
Фарм друлей в воде, без копки. Пет перестал идти в атаку первым, ждет вместе с друлей окончания времени задержки. diagnost если это сделано специально, то можно ли опционально вернуть старый порядок атаки? А еще лучше было бы сделать 2 задержки, на атаку персом и петом по отдельности.
Через полчаса работы бот вылетел
В логе вот это:
Код:
==== поднятие лута ======
Поднимать в радиусе : 100
Найден лут Отличная микстура бодрости
Расстояние до него 1
о_О, есть лут в наличии! Будет что намазать на хлебушек.
Бежим к луту Отличная микстура бодрости по координатам ХХХ ХХХ 19,7 1 и поднимаем его
=== Условия для выполнения блока атаки ===
GamerInfo.TargetID <> 0: False
cbAttak.Checked: True
not UsedSkill: True
not Danger: True
GamerInfo.TargetID <> GamerInfo.PetWID: True
not fHeightFly or PersUnderAtak: True
=========== Конец цикла. =============
======== Начало цикла. ========
======== Связь с клиентом имеется. Читаем всю необходимую информацию. ========
Свой баф_№_81__Покрывало цветов _ Увеличивает скорость перемещения
Количество игроков 0-в пати
Mob баф_№_ = 0 0 0 0
Надет джин 00005CC9
Набрали опыта 60522/85510 (71%)
Проверяем наличие счастливых мешочков
Находимся в воде
В таргете никого нет: сбрасываем флаг атаки
ХП: 81
МП: 93
Пет в хиле не нуждается
Время бафаться еще не пришло...
==== покупка/продажа/починка ======
Инвентарь полон, но сработало ограничение на продажу. Продавать не будем.
Сработало по времени
Услове для покупки/продажи/починки сработало
Двигаемся к 32-й точке маршрута для продажи/починки
Двигаемся к кординатам ХХХ ХХХ 21,4 1 (мои координаты ХХХ ХХХ 19,9 1)
Условия для лута:
PickUpLut.Checked : True
GamerInfo.TargetID = 0 : True
not UseDiedMotion : True
not UseNPCMotion : False
not Danger : True
not PetHill : True
=== Условия для выполнения блока атаки ===
GamerInfo.TargetID <> 0: False
cbAttak.Checked: True
not UsedSkill: True
not Danger: True
GamerInfo.TargetID <> GamerInfo.PetWID: True
not fHeightFly or PersUnderAtak: True
=========== Конец цикла. =============
======== Начало цикла. ========
======== Связь с клиентом имеется. Читаем всю необходимую информацию. ========
Свой баф_№_ = 0 0 0 0
Количество игроков 0-в пати
Mob баф_№_ = 0 0 0 0
Воскрешение пристом/мистиком
Перс мёртв
Воскрешение в город
Пробовал и свой маршрут и автопилот, результат одинаков.
Если бег по маршруту не работает - прошу прощения, запутался малость в версиях (что... где работает?)
Кстати, обратил внимание, что при отключенной поддержке пета дру продолжает его кормить и хилит если хп падает ниже выставленного.
Последний раз редактировалось Drimming; 28.07.2015 в 20:30.
[Ссылки могут видеть только зарегистрированные пользователи. ], на данный момент эту тестирую.
С инжектом движения закончил, больше изменяться не будет(проверено инжектируется правильно).
Последний раз редактировалось diagnost; 29.07.2015 в 08:19.
Версия 5_29 - друля в воде, битье мобов, сбор лута в радиусе 100, продажа/починка на автопилоте.
Пет теперь снова первым рвется в бой Вот только вылеты продолжаются
Лог вылета:
Код:
==== поднятие лута ======
Поднимать в радиусе : 100
Найден лут Монеты
Расстояние до него 3
о_О, есть лут в наличии! Будет что намазать на хлебушек.
Бежим к луту Монеты по координатам ХХХ ХХХ 20,3 3 и поднимаем его
=== Условия для выполнения блока атаки ===
GamerInfo.TargetID <> 0: False
cbAttak.Checked: True
not UsedSkill: True
not Danger: True
GamerInfo.TargetID <> GamerInfo.PetWID: True
not fHeightFly or PersUnderAtak: True
=========== Конец цикла. =============
======== Начало цикла. ========
======== Связь с клиентом имеется. Читаем всю необходимую информацию. ========
Свой баф_№_ = 0 0 0 0
Количество игроков 0-в пати
Mob баф_№_ = 0 0 0 0
Надет джин 00005CC9
Набрали опыта 61938/85510 (72%)
Проверяем наличие счастливых мешочков
Находимся в воде
В таргете никого нет: сбрасываем флаг атаки
ХП: 100
МП: 93
Пет в хиле не нуждается
Время бафаться еще не пришло...
==== покупка/продажа/починка ======
Условия для лута:
PickUpLut.Checked : True
GamerInfo.TargetID = 0 : True
not UseDiedMotion : True
not UseNPCMotion : True
not Danger : True
not PetHill : True
==== поднятие лута ======
Поднимать в радиусе : 100
Усё, брать больше нечего :(
Где тут наши мобики?
Ан нэт никого, сдох стрекоз :(
=== Условия для выполнения блока атаки ===
GamerInfo.TargetID <> 0: False
cbAttak.Checked: True
not UsedSkill: True
not Danger: True
GamerInfo.TargetID <> GamerInfo.PetWID: True
not fHeightFly or PersUnderAtak: True
Иду домой... к центру.
Двигаемся к кординатам ХХХ ХХХ 20,9 1 (мои координаты ХХХ ХХХ 20,2 1)
Двигаемся к кординатам ХХХ ХХХ 20,9 1 (мои координаты ХХХ ХХХ 20,2 1)
=========== Конец цикла. =============
======== Начало цикла. ========
======== Связь с клиентом имеется. Читаем всю необходимую информацию. ========
Свой баф_№_ = 0 0 0 0
Количество игроков 0-в пати
Mob баф_№_ = 0 0 0 0
Перс мёртв
Выходим из цикла в блоке СМЕРТИ.
=========== Конец цикла. =============
diagnost, как этот лог посмотреть?нажимаю на глаз там выскакивает окошко с единственным словом: Лог и все..или мб гдето галочку надо поставить?
Сделать снимок нажми
Добавлено через 19 минут
У меня вылетел, зашел стоит около нипа продажи и починки.( уже хорошо, раньше в полете клиент падал). Буду переделывать остальные инжекты.
Последний раз редактировалось diagnost; 29.07.2015 в 20:54.
Причина: Добавлено сообщение
Пет теперь снова первым рвется в бой Вот только вылеты продолжаются
Ребята - оставьте инжект движения в покое! Бот РАБОТАЕТ и работает ХОРОШО!!! Группа из шести по данджам, плюс 3-4 дополнительных...Окна ВЫЛЕТАЮТ ИЗ-ЗА ПАМЯТИ, а не из-за бота!!! У меня последний раз вылетел ПРОСТО ПЕРС запущенный, а боты все шпарили - только в путь! Перезагружайтесь, перезаходите через несколько часов, не нужно лениться сделать несколько лишних движений...Автор, если еще что-то найдет - он обязательно сам все сделает...Предлагаю меньше писАть о вылетах, больше делиться опытом - кто и где его еще использует и - главное КАК...Например - ботодру: вкладка контроль жизнь 50% - Жизненная сила, 30% - гармония...То же в мане 50% - духовная сила, 30% - гармония...
Win-7х64 5_29 на радиусе может и больще 12 часов стоять ,а на маршруте 30мин-2 часа и вылет(копка рессов)
[Ссылки могут видеть только зарегистрированные пользователи. ] исправил инжект продажи по тому же принципу что и инж движения. Завтра исправлю инж подбора лута и копки ресов.(Тестирую уже час, каждые 10 мин летает к нипу, вылетов пока нет)
[Ссылки могут видеть только зарегистрированные пользователи. ]
Изменен инж. подбора лута и копки ресов.
Последний раз редактировалось diagnost; 30.07.2015 в 07:52.
[Ссылки могут видеть только зарегистрированные пользователи. ] исправил инжект продажи по тому же принципу что и инж движения. Завтра исправлю инж подбора лута и копки ресов.(Тестирую уже час, каждые 10 мин летает к нипу, вылетов пока нет)
[Ссылки могут видеть только зарегистрированные пользователи. ]
Изменен инж. подбора лута и копки ресов.
c версией 5_31 - 3 часа полёт нормальный
Добавлено через 19 минут
и снова светофор. вылетает именно то окно на котором бот. при копке ресов.
Последний раз редактировалось Arti Trionel; 30.07.2015 в 13:26.
Причина: Добавлено сообщение
Добавлено через 19 минут
и снова светофор. вылетает именно то окно на котором бот. при копке ресов.
Вечером поправлю инжект использования скиллов. Обрати внимание при в ходе на перса сразу после вылета мобы агряться? Есть подозрение, что бот пытался защищаться от нападения.( надо баг убрать с копкой ресов, возможно из-за этого клиент падает).
Последний раз редактировалось diagnost; 30.07.2015 в 15:37.
после захода в игру мобы не агрятса. вылет идёт на половине круга. и всегда светофор. поставил на радиус почемуто дёргаетса на месте и ноль реакции.
ресы копает на кругу отлично, вот только вылеты ети уже надоели.
спасипо автору за работу.